Crash site of Typhoon EK370
23/02/1944

aircraft
cest raf squadron
Unit: 3 Squadron
Aircraft: Typhoon
Code: EK370
Base: Manston
Mission: Zeebrugge
Crew officer: Caporal Fudala Jozeph
Incident: Hit by German Flak

Location: (Prov. West-Vlanderen)

crash

Facts

Fudal took part in Operation Roadsted. This was the British overall designation of offensive air sweeps by day, using low-level and dive-bombing attacks, against German shipping. His Typhoon IB QO-C (EK370) was hit by German Anti Aircraft while executing his mission along the Zeebrugge, Belgium coastline. The pilot bailed at about 600m, landed in the sea and drowned.
